Patron Electric Portable Heaters

For Heavy Duty and Professional Use


There are many reasons why you would want to use an electric heater on a job site.  You have no exhaust or ventilation issues to deal with.  You also never need to clean up fuel spills or have fuel odors in the area you are working.  Electric heaters are 100% efficient and environmentally GREEN.  There design is simple and therefore less likely to break down and if you do have a problem they are easier to repair.

When you need electric heat on a construction job site you need a heater that is built to handle years of abuse.  Look for heating elements that are made of copper and coated in Magnesium, then enclosed in a stainless steel jacket.  Find one with a high quality sealed blower motor and a rugged steel powder coated housing.  Make sure they have some type of overheat and tip over protection.

Electric heat is capable of a very quick and high temperature rise as long as you have an industrial-grade fan to distribute the air though the room you are heating.  Electric heaters come in different sizes and run on different voltages depending on the wattage rating.

Patron makes 4 different size Portable Electric Heaters for the professional.

E 1.5 - 5,100 BTU/hr 116 CFM air flow
E 3 - 10,200 BTU/hr 205 CFM air flow
E 9 - 30,700 BTU/hr 350 CFM air flow
 

New this season is the Patron E 6  20,500 BTU/hr 250 CFM air flow
